Output 21a5df620908b069b95fc9da768e244292f3a097e9b1f061284c02247b88c86f:14

value
408760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 179de50bf1de2158e67f08df04bdcd143239e91b OP_EQUAL
address
33qtcfypDdGfTNfV4QAPCVdrXBjLN7D4Wc
transaction
21a5df620908b069b95fc9da768e244292f3a097e9b1f061284c02247b88c86f
spent
true